Andrey Rublev continues attack on ‘absurd’ Roger Federer farce – Yahoo Sport Australia
Andrey Rublev has joined Alexander Zverev in hitting out at the ATP’s revised rankings.

Andrey Rublev has criticised the ATP’s revised rankings system. Image: Getty
Andrey Rublev has joined Alexander Zverev in criticising the ATP’s revised rankings system, bemoaning the fact he’s still down at World No.8.
Earlier this week Zverev (World No.7) said it was “absurd” he remained behind Roger Federer under the new system, having won two titles and finishing runner-up at a grand slam and a Masters 1000 event.
